Switzerland, Canton of Vaud, Montreux, Lake Leman, cruise ship of the CGN company, the Franco-Swiss Alps in the background
Size: 6720px × 4480px
Location: Montreux
Photo credit: © MOIRENC Camille / hemis.fr /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: genevamontreux, lakeswitzerlandeuropecanton, peoplewater, vaudlake